VERBS.
- The 'infinitive'.
The infinitive is the basic form of every verb. It is given in the word list.- Changing the actor.
Different actors are indicated by different suffixes:- Changing the tense.
Different tenses are indicated by different prefixes:- Special suffixes
- tahv makes verb into a noun
- tahn makes verb into a noun that is a person
- ahl forms a participle/adjective from the verb
- ah indicates imperativeNOUNS.
- The definite article.
The D'ni definite article is the prefix "reh-".- The indefinite article.
The indefinite article is the prefix "ehrth-".- Plural form.
Plural of nouns is indicated by the suffix "-tee".- Special suffix
- ehts makes noun into adjectiveADJECTIVES.
- Word order.
The adjective is placed after the noun.- Special suffixes.
- th makes a noun
- sh changes into an adverbOTHER GRAMMAR.
- Possession.
Possession is indicated by the words "oykh", "t'" and "tso", roughly equivalent to "of".THE COMPLETE ALPHABET.
